Abstract
A series of K2La(1-x)Eux(PO3)(5) (x = 0.5; 1; 5; 10) polycrystalline powders were prepared with flux method. The obtained powders are characterized by X-ray powder diffraction and FTIR spectroscopy. These polyphosphates crystallize in the monoclinic phase with space group Cc. Spectroscopic properties of the Eu3+. doped K2La(PO3)(5) at room temperature (RT) are investigated based on the emission and excitation spectra and the photoluminescence decay time. The colorimetric properties of the Eu3+ ions emission in each compound were investigated. Europium doped K2La(PO3)(5) could be a potential red phosphor for optical devices. (C) 2018 Elsevier GmbH.
